What Is Semen Analysis?

Semen analysis is a key test in male fertility workups. It offers a full look at sperm health by checking the amount, movement, shape, and environment of sperm in a sample. This test gives facts that help doctors spot issues with sperm that may impact a couple’s ability to have a child.

Results can help guide the next steps for diagnosis and treatment. Most labs in the U.S. Report results in just a few days, making it a practical first step for many.

Defining This Key Fertility Test

A semen analysis measures sperm health in a clear, methodical way. Doctors use it to see how well sperm move (motility), how many are present (count), and what they look like (morphology).

Other details checked include the semen’s pH and volume. A normal sperm count ranges from 20 million to over 200 million per milliliter. At least half of the sperm should swim well, and more than 14% should have a regular shape.

These facts help find out if male infertility could be a factor. About 40% of infertility cases come from sperm issues, so this test is often the first step.

1. Volume: The Total Amount

Semen volume measures the total fluid released in one ejaculation. The normal range is about 1.5 to 6 milliliters. Lower than normal volume can point to issues like blockages, hormone imbalances, or problems with the seminal vesicles or prostate.

If the volume is too low, there may not be enough fluid to carry sperm through the reproductive tract, making fertilization less likely. On the flip side, very high volumes can dilute sperm, lowering the concentration and possibly the chances of conception.

When looking at semen volume, it’s important to check it alongside other results like sperm count and motility since one reading alone rarely gives the whole picture.

2. Sperm Count: How Many?

Sperm count, called concentration, tells how many sperm are in each milliliter of semen. A normal sperm count is at least 15 million sperm per milliliter or 39 million per ejaculate. Results below 15 million per milliliter mean a low sperm count, known as oligospermia.

If there are no sperm at all, it is called azoospermia. High counts, above 200 million per milliliter, are uncommon but possible. Sperm count can change day-to-day and may be affected by recent illness, stress, or how long it’s been since the last ejaculation.

Both very low and very high counts can affect fertility, though count alone does not guarantee success. For example, a man might have a normal count but poor motility or morphology, leading to trouble conceiving.

3. Motility: The Swimmers’ Speed

Motility is a measure of how efficiently sperm swim. This is particularly critical as sperm are required to swim through the long and often hostile female reproductive tract to reach and fertilize the egg.

Motility is usually broken down by percentage: over 50% of sperm should be motile, meaning they move actively. Progressive motility, or active movement in a forward direction, is the best type of motility when it comes to fertilization.

Motility is scored from 0 (no movement) to 4 (strong, straight movement). Usually, a forward progression of 2 or more is deemed acceptable. Poor motility, or asthenozoospermia, causes difficulty for sperm making their way to the egg, despite a normal sperm count.

5. pH: Acidity and Alkalinity

Semen pH checks if the fluid is acidic or alkaline. Normal semen is slightly alkaline, usually between 7.2 and 8.0. This range helps protect sperm from the acidic environment of the vagina and supports sperm survival.

If pH is too low (acidic) or too high (alkaline), sperm may not swim well or survive long enough to reach the egg. Low pH can hint at blockages, while high pH often suggests infection.

6. White Blood Cells: Infection Clues

White blood cells (WBCs) are not usually found in high numbers in semen. A small presence is common, but high levels can point to infection or inflammation of the reproductive tract. Doctors call this condition leukocytospermia.

An infection can hurt sperm quality and function. If a semen analysis finds many WBCs, further testing is often needed, like urine cultures or tests for sexually transmitted infections.

7. Liquefaction Time: Gel to Liquid

Right after ejaculation, semen has a thick, jelly-like texture. It should turn to a liquid in about 15 to 30 minutes at room temperature. This process is called liquefaction, and it lets sperm swim freely.

If liquefaction takes longer, sperm can get trapped in the gel, slowing or blocking their movement. Delayed liquefaction can be due to infection or issues with the prostate or seminal vesicles.

8. Fructose Level: Sperm Energy Source

Fructose in semen provides energy for sperm movement. The main source is the seminal vesicles. Low fructose may signal a blockage or damage to these glands.

Without enough fructose, sperm may lack the energy to swim far or fast. Measuring fructose helps spot some rare causes of low or absent sperm in the semen.

What Are Reference Ranges?

Reference ranges represent the range of numbers typically seen in healthy adult men. These values are used to help physicians interpret the results. The truth is, every person is different.

Things such as age, health, and lifestyle can change these outcomes. Therefore, what’s considered “normal” for one individual may appear abnormal for another.

“Abnormal” Doesn’t Mean Infertile

Just because something is abnormal doesn’t mean one cannot conceive naturally. A lot of men with low sperm counts or strange-shaped sperm go on to have perfectly healthy children.

It’s a better approach, really — considering the whole health picture rather than relying on a singular test.

One Test, Many Factors

A single semen test does not give the whole story. Sperm counts and motility can vary between samples. Health, habits, and even timing matter.

Doctors often repeat tests for a clearer view.

Influences on Your Semen Results

Many different things can change the outcome of a semen analysis. These include everyday choices, your health, how you collect the sample, and even the lab that runs the test. Understanding these factors helps you and your healthcare provider get the most accurate picture of your fertility.

Lifestyle factors that can affect semen analysis results include diet and nutrition, alcohol use and smoking, stress levels, body fat and waistline size, regular exercise, recent illness or fever, and use of recreational drugs.

Lifestyle: Diet, Stress, Habits

What you eat and how you live can increase or decrease sperm health. In general, a diet rich in fruits, vegetables, and lean protein is better for sperm. Excessive alcohol consumption, smoking, and recreational drugs negatively affect sperm count and motility.

Stress can be influential, with the potential to reduce sperm quality or sperm count. While regular exercise is beneficial, excessive or intense exercise can have the opposite effect. Maintaining a healthy level of body fat and blood pressure helps; high levels are associated with decreased sperm counts.

Reducing negative lifestyle choices and establishing new healthy habits can set you on the right path to restoring your fertility.

Health and Medications Impact

Health issues like diabetes, infections, or hormone problems can shape semen results. Medicines for high blood pressure, depression, or cancer can lower sperm count or change how sperm move.

Always let your doctor know about any medications or supplements you use. This helps avoid confusion and ensures test results reflect your real health.

Collection Technique is Crucial

To obtain a representative sample, there are very strict guidelines that need to be adhered to. Do not have sexual intercourse for 2 to 7 days prior to the test.

Produce the specimen in a sterile cup at the clinic or at home. Just don’t forget to store it at room temperature, about 68°F. Even minimal fluctuations in temperature or time in transit can affect the results.

Using clean hands and tools will help prevent contamination. Occasionally, you will be required to provide multiple samples as sperm counts can vary day-to-day.

Lab Differences and Accuracy

Not all labs follow the same process. Accredited labs use strict steps to test semen. This means results are more likely to be right and the same each time.

Standardization matters—choosing a trusted lab helps make sure your results are real and reliable.

Frequently Asked Questions

What is a semen analysis?

A semen analysis is a lab test that checks the health and quality of a man’s sperm. It helps assess fertility by measuring sperm count, movement, shape, and other key details.

What do normal semen analysis results look like?

Normal results include a sperm count above 15 million per milliliter, more than 40% motility, and over 4% normal-shaped sperm. Semen volume should be at least 1.5 milliliters.

What can affect semen analysis results?

Stress, illness, medication, smoking, alcohol use, and fever within the last seven days can affect results. It’s true that even short-term lifestyle changes can have an impact.

How do I prepare for a semen analysis?

Doctors suggest abstinence of 2 to 5 days prior to testing. Do not drink alcohol, use tobacco, or drugs, and disclose any medications you take to your healthcare provider.

What does “abnormal” mean in my semen analysis report?

Abnormal” simply indicates that one or more of your measurements are not within the normal range. This doesn’t necessarily indicate infertility—most causes are treatable or come and go.

Should I get a second semen analysis?

Yes, many doctors suggest a repeat test after a few weeks. This helps confirm results, since sperm quality can change due to many factors.

What are the next steps after an abnormal semen analysis?

Follow up with a urologist or male fertility specialist. They can help you interpret your report, advise you on healthy lifestyle choices, and order additional tests or treatments if necessary.
